Summary

Wellington Bomber HF570 of 84 Operational Training Unit (RAF Desborough) crashed on 5th September 1944 during a training flight. Three air crew were killed and three survived.

Full Description

{1} Photographs of memorial.

{2} A stone of remembrance unveiled 15th October 2022. It comprises an unfinished rectangular block of York Stone with a square, polished, black granite plaque on the front face. The plaque bears an inscription to the three aircrew who died in the crash.

{3} The aircraft crashed on the Braybrooke Road between Desborough and Harrington. Provides details of all the aircrew especially Reginald Bryne.
